Question: How does wearing a hijab (which is a personal decision) relate to social facts?
1. In the Islamic tradition, it is considered more appropriate for girls above a certain age to
wear the hijab because it is thought of as a valuable religious symbol. Therefore, although
the decision to wear the veil depends on the individual, the religious tradition of the
family and the Muslim community has a great influence on the individuals choice.
3. In very few Arab countries where the Islamic Law (Sharia) is practiced to the extreme,
women are forced to wear the hijab regardless of whether they are Muslim or not. In this
particular case, wearing the veil has become one of the ways of enforcing strict rules to
women only.
